本文目录导读:
随着互联网的快速发展,网络安全问题日益凸显,为了保障用户信息和网站数据的完整性与安全性,网站认证源码成为了一个至关重要的环节,本文将带领大家深入了解网站认证源码的技术奥秘与安全机制,揭示其背后的神秘面纱。
网站认证源码概述
网站认证源码是指实现网站用户认证功能的代码,主要包括用户登录、注册、密码找回等功能,它通常由服务器端和客户端两部分组成,服务器端负责处理认证请求,客户端负责发送认证请求。
图片来源于网络,如有侵权联系删除
网站认证源码技术奥秘
1、加密技术
为了确保用户信息安全,网站认证源码采用了加密技术,常见的加密算法有MD5、SHA-1、SHA-256等,加密技术可以将用户密码、个人信息等敏感数据转化为难以破解的密文,有效防止黑客窃取。
2、安全协议
网站认证源码通常采用安全协议,如HTTPS、SSL等,这些协议在数据传输过程中对数据进行加密,防止中间人攻击,确保用户数据安全。
3、验证码技术
为了防止恶意用户通过自动化工具进行攻击,网站认证源码引入了验证码技术,验证码分为图形验证码和短信验证码两种,有效降低了自动化攻击的风险。
4、密码找回机制
当用户忘记密码时,网站认证源码提供了密码找回机制,通常包括邮箱验证、手机验证等方式,帮助用户恢复账户。
图片来源于网络,如有侵权联系删除
5、防止暴力破解
为了防止恶意用户通过暴力破解密码,网站认证源码设置了密码尝试次数限制,当连续输入错误密码达到一定次数后,系统将暂时锁定账户,有效防止恶意攻击。
网站认证源码安全机制
1、身份验证
网站认证源码通过用户名、密码等身份信息进行验证,确保用户身份的真实性。
2、权限控制
网站认证源码对用户权限进行控制,确保用户只能访问其授权访问的资源。
3、日志记录
网站认证源码记录用户操作日志,便于管理员跟踪用户行为,及时发现异常情况。
图片来源于网络,如有侵权联系删除
4、防火墙与入侵检测
网站认证源码部署防火墙和入侵检测系统,对恶意攻击进行防御,确保网站安全。
5、定期更新与维护
网站认证源码需要定期更新和维护,以修复已知漏洞,提高系统安全性。
网站认证源码是保障网络安全的关键环节,通过深入了解其技术奥秘与安全机制,我们可以更好地认识网站认证的重要性,为用户和网站提供更加安全可靠的服务,在今后的工作中,我们要不断优化网站认证源码,为构建安全、稳定的网络环境贡献力量。
标签: #网站认证源码
评论列表